Dr. Banwell is a Pediatric resident at the University of Utah. She sees infants, children, and adolescents for preventive health care and acute visits at the University Pediatric Clinic. She was born and raised in Toronto, Ontario before completing medical school at the University of Pennsylvania. Her interests include Neonatology and Newborn care. Outside of work she enjoys skiing, paddle boarding, and hiking with her husband and their dog Phoebe.
